Former Goldman Sachs hedge fund manager and crypto billionaire Mike Novogratz has recently weighed on the crypto market situation amid the ongoing Russia-Ukraine war crisis.
Speaking to Bloomberg on Tuesday, March 1, Novogratz said that the Russia-Ukraine war will serve as a potential booster to Bitcoin and crypto while moving people away from the U.S. Dollar.
Russia has been facing severe sanctions with the world isolating the aggressor from the global financial system SWIFT. As a result, the Russian ruble has lost 40% of its value against the USD over the last week dropping to a multi-decade low. On the other hand, Ukraine has also cut down on the use of local currency and has started accepting crypto donations to fund its war against Russia.
Novogratz believes that such sanctions and curbs are likely to push people towards adopting the decentralized currency. However, he made it clear that it doesn’t mean Bitcoin or crypto serves as a tool to avoid sanctions.here's your source bro:)

Airbnb announced Monday that it is offering free temporary housing for up to 100,000 refugees from Ukraine. Since the start of the Russian invasion, more than 600,000 civilians have fled Ukraine, according to the UN. The European Union estimates that up to four million people may try to leave Ukraine because of the Russian invasion.
“We reached out to governments in Poland and Germany and Hungary and Romania, and countries even west of them to offer assistance,” the Airbnb CEO explained.
“We’ve been reaching out to our hosts. We’ve secured funding and so we’re prepared to house up to 100,000 refugees,” he shared. “Frankly, we can house as many refugees as we have hosts.”
